I have tried cases but never got on with any. Got an invisibleshield and just use a toothpick to clean out the holes every now and again. Just be conscious of it, I always make sure the screen is to my leg in my pocket. I can only then break the back bit if I get whipped or hit with something.

Posted

The shields will still work with almost any case. Some slide in an out ones it grips too much but it saves having a million scratches on your screen. Then go to istyles.com to get a skin. Bulk free and scratch proof case!

Posted

The Switcheasy Capsule Rebel is the best that I've found. It's not Otter Box rugged, but gives a surprising amount of protection without adding too much bulk. It comes with screen protectors thrown in as well which is a bonus.
